Mit Docker volumes lassen sich Container-Daten persistieren und teilen. Volumes befinden sich außerhalb des Containers. Wird ein Container gelöscht, bleibt das vom Container verwendete Volume erhalten.
Grundsätzlich ist es nicht möglich, ein volume an einen laufenden Container anzuhängen. Es ist jedoch möglich, ein neues image von einem Container zu erstellen und dieses image neu zu starten.
docker commit [name_or_id] newimagename
docker run -ti -v "$PWD/ordner1":/ordner1 -v "$PWD/ordner2":/ordner2 newimagename bash